** The Treaty of Versailles that ended UsefulNotes/WorldWarI is often accused of laying the groundwork for UsefulNotes/WorldWarII by creating numerous grievances among both the victors and the vanquished while also leaving Germany in a position to rebuild their empire. The armistice also helped spread the "Stab in the Back" myth that Germany had not been defeated in the field but simply betrayed by their government.[[note]]In truth, the Germans were depleted and on the retreat on the Western front after the American entry into the war and the introduction of tanks on the Allied side. Meanwhile, the Balkan front had completely collapsed already and the Allies were pushing up to Vienna, which would have allowed them to knock Austria-Hungary out of the war and outflank Germany's western and eastern army group forces completely.[[/note]] During [=WWII=], the Allies demanded nothing less than unconditional surrender surrender[[note]]At the insistence of President Roosevelt, who realized that the Germans needed to know that they had been defeated fully. Churchill and ''especially'' Stalin were more hesitant on this policy, since they were aware that their countries would suffer more from a longer war.[[/note]] and occupied and de-Nazified Germany so they wouldn't have to deal with a resurgent FourthReich ever again.
